  • Patent number: 5520557
    Abstract: A hydrojet for ships, intended for use in shallow waters, has a semiaxially bladed impeller with a vertical axis of rotation rotatably arranged in a well-shaped housing. The drive for the impeller is introduced into the housing from the top through a cover plate, and the housing is closed at the bottom by a bottom plate which has a water inlet arranged in the center for axial admission to the impeller and at least one flatly sloped water outlet. A control device in which the water delivered by the impeller is fed to at least one outlet nozzle without conversion of kinetic energy into pressure energy, is arranged between the discharge end of the delivery channels of the impeller and at least one water outlet. The control device forms a ring channel without blading. The water inlet is designed asymmetrically.

  • Patent number: 5435762
    Abstract: Propulsion unit for watercraft, with a drive shafting (3) between a drive motor (2) and a propulsive device (1), wherein this propulsion unit with vertical drive shafting is arranged in the shaft-like housing (12) of the hull (14) such that the distance between the motor and the propulsive device is adjustable. The motor (2) acts on the drive shafting (3) via a disengaging coupling (19), and is adjustable in the horizontal plane between two end positions when the coupling (19) is disengaged, wherein the motor (2) and the drive shafting (3) can be coupled with one another in one end position, and the drive shafting (3) with the propulsive device (1) associated with it can be moved past the motor in the other end position of the motor (2).

  • Patent number: 5235266
    Abstract: An energy-generating plant including a solar generator, having solar cells, for producing electrical energy. The electrical energy is supplied to a direct current converter, the output power of which may be used to charge an energy storage system, such as batteries. The input resistance of the direct current converter is adapted, such as by a microcomputer, to the maximum power point (MPP) of the solar generator, the MPP being dependent upon the solar insolation and the temperature of the solar cells. At start up of the plant, or when there is a change of power at the output of the direct current converter, a search process is carried out to attain the MPP of the solar generator. The energy storage system may be used to energize an electric motor for driving the propeller of a ship.

  • Patent number: 4519335
    Abstract: A watercraft includes two steerable propellers driven by motors, the angular positions of and the thrusts produced by the steerable propellers being controlled by a control system. The control system includes an input device having a frame, a head and a handwheel supported on the frame for independent pivotal movement about a common first axis, and a lever supported on the head for pivotal movement about a second axis normal to the first axis. The head, handwheel and lever are each operatively coupled to a respective input element by a respective gear arrangement. A microcomputer responsive to the input elements is connected through several control devices to the motor and the steerable propellers for effecting the requisite control thereof.

  • Patent number: 4418633
    Abstract: An apparatus for driving and controlling a watercraft or the like having at least one pair of steerable propellers, the steerable propellers of each pair being located substantially symmetrically on opposite sides of the center line of the watercraft, such center line extending through the center of lateral resistance of the watercraft. A control element is provided for carrying out control movements in two degrees of freedom. Each control movement acts for remote control of the steerable propellers through transmitters corresponding respectively to such steerable propellers. Movement of the control element in one degree of freedom effects a rotation about an axis for controlling, through the transmitters, a synchronous pivoting of the servo propellers of each pair. Movement of the control element in the second degree of freedom effects movement of a rack element for controlling, through the same transmitters, an oppositely directed pivoting of the servo propellers relative to one another.

  • Patent number: 4334489
    Abstract: A reversing mechanism for steerable propellers on ships wherein the direction of travel of the ship is controlled by the position of the steerable propeller. A selector switch is provided for controlling the direction of travel as well as directions forward and rearward such that when the direction of travel is to be reversed, the steerable propeller will be sequentially disengaged from the propeller driving mechanism and automatically pivoted through 180.degree. to effect a reverse operation without altering the position of the steering control. In other words, the position of the steerable propeller will be altered without altering the position of the steering control when the direction of travel of the ship is to be reversed.

  • Patent number: 4278431
    Abstract: A hydro-jet drive for watercraft. A device is provided applicable for mounting in the hull of a boat by which a jet stream can be created and directed in any desired direction for movement of the boat accordingly. There is provided an elbow having an intake portion and a substantially horizontal discharge opening. The elbow is rotatable on an axis of rotation and contains a suitable motor driven impeller. A motor driven device is provided for rotating the elbow about the axis of rotation thereof for effecting discharge in an operator determined direction. The axis of rotation of the impeller is arranged eccentrically with respect to the axis of rotation of the elbow. The device is particularly adaptable for shallow draft vessels.

  • Patent number: 4175511
    Abstract: A steerable propeller arrangement in a watercraft wherein the propeller is mounted in the forward one-half of the hull of the watercraft. The steerable propeller projects downwardly from the bottom portion of the hull and is pivotal about 360.degree.. The propeller is mounted in a downwardly opening cylindrical well in the bottom of the hull and is housed in an inner cylindrical member which is spaced radially inwardly from an outer cylindrical wall defining the well in the hull. The steerable propeller arrangement can be removed from the hull by raising the inner cylindrical member and propeller upwardly into the interior of the watercraft. Thrust blocks are provided between the two cylindrical members to absorb thrust applied by the drivable propeller arrangement.
